Findspot of Silver Roman Coin and Roman British Pottery in Tysoe.
Description of this historic site
A silver coin of Honorius and two sherds of Romano British pottery found during a field walking exercise in Tysoe parish, 600m northeast of the church.

Notes about this historic site
1 A silver Roman Honorius coin and two Romano British potsherds found during systematic field walking.
2 Further finds at SP346446 of a coin of Constantine 1, a quern fragment, and some potsherds were made in the autumn of 1995. The method of recovery was not recorded.
